Frequently Asked Questions about San Antonio
How much are Studio apartments in San Antonio?
There are currently 515 Studio Apartments in San Antonio with rent ranges from $450 to $2,456 with an average price of $1,071.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om San Antonio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in San Antonio ranges from $480 to $4,375 with an average monthly rent of $1,202.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in San Antonio c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in San Antonio range from $295 to $10,937.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,543.
How expensive are San Antonio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 997 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in San Antonio on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$337 to $12,331 - averaging $1,974 for the location.
